Comedy superstar Tom Allen is already a household name on TV, from Cooking With the Stars to Bake Off: An Extra Slice. Now he brings his acerbic wit and riotous storytelling to this discussion of his debut novel, in which all hell breaks loose in sleepy suburbia.
Common Decency chronicles the lives of one street’s residents as they band together to save a beloved oak tree from destruction at the hands of ruthless developers. As tensions rise and repressed neuroses and resentments seep out, the secrets of Oak Drive threaten to shatter the veneer of order, revealing some surprising truths.
